Is My Neck Pain Caused by Stress? Pain worsened by keeping your head in one place — like when you’re driving, or using a computer — is neck pain. While neck pain has a slew of symptoms, its major symptoms, reported by We-Fix-U, are: • Muscle tightness and spasms • Headache • Decreased ability to move the head Stress-induced neck pain isn’t rare. It also isn’t psychological. Many physiotherapists think stress-induced neck pain is caused by physical factors — low, but constant, trapezius muscle activity. If your neck pain starts at the base of your shoulders, traveling upward, it may be stress related. Causes of Stress-Related Neck Pain While stress alone can trigger neck pain, a few factors can make it worse. Office environments tend to create neck pain problems — as they confine people to chairs, bad posture and little mobility. Driving often, too, can make your chances of stress-related neck pain higher.

• COBOURG (905) 373-7045 • PORT HOPE (905) 885-0024 • PETERBOROUGH (705) 270-0606 • BOWMANVILLE (905) 233-4374 • OSHAWA (905) 433-7675

The National Library of Medicine suggests contacting a Health Care professional like a Physiotherapist, Chiropractor or Reg. Massage therapist if you’re experiencing neck pain. Even if it’s caused by stress, untreated neck pain might later reveal muscle spasms, arthritis, bulging discs or even narrowed spinal nerve openings.

HOWPHYSIOTHERAPY & CHIROPRACTIC CAN HELP NECK PAIN

Neck pain, fortunately, can be alleviated with physiotherapy, massage and chiropractic programs. Because neck pain is often caused by activity, different activity can cure it. Sometimes, this “activity” means “no activity.” Before you contact a professional, try reducing your neck movements. Sometimes, simply letting your neck muscles relax is enough. If you don’t see relief within two weeks, contact a professional. Physiotherapists, Reg. massage therapists or Chiropractors can target your pain’s source by examining your symptoms. Then, they can offer exercises that stress, flex and relax your neck muscles. In time, your neck will become more resilient — giving you the comfort you deserve. Where after-care treatment is considered, custom-tailored neck exercises will assure your neck stays loose, limber and healthy. If you’re dealing with neck pain, you’re not alone. Veggie Hummus Rolls Recipe

INGREDIENTS • 2 vegan whole wheat wraps • 1/2 cup diced red peppers • 1/2 cup diced yellow pepper • 1/2 cup diced red cabbage

• 2 large carrots, peeled • 6 - 8 tbsp. no-oil, low-salt hummus • 2 tbsp. raw sunflower seeds (or your choice of raw seeds)

INSTRUCTIONS Heat wraps for 10 to 20 seconds in the microwave. Spread each wrap with 3 to 4 tbsp of no-oil hummus (depending on the diameter of your wrap). Divide veggies and sprinkle on top of the hummus on each wrap. Make sure to stop your veggies about 2 inches down from the edge of the tortillas (this will help the wraps seal up better). Starting on the opposite end, roll upwards tightly and press down to seal. Eat as whole wraps or cut into 1 1/2 to 2 inch pieces to make sushi-like rolls.

WHEN DOES IT OCCUR Fungus infection occurs when fungal debris becomes trapped under the nail, often as the result of an injury to the nail. It can be contracted in damp areas, such as public gyms, showers, or pools. Athletes and people who wear tight fitting shoes or hosiery, which can irritate the nails and retain moisture around them, are at a higher risk. Diabetics and people with other chronic conditions also have a higher risk of getting toenail fungus. As toenail fungus grows and spreads deeper into the nail, it can cause the nail to swell and become discolored-depending on the type of fungus, the color of the toenail can vary between brown, yellow or white. The fungus can also cause the nail to thicken and to crumble, and in some cases, it will cause the nail to completely detach. Toenail fungus also can be painful, causing irritation and burning in the infected area; sometimes, even wearing shoes becomes a painful ordeal for the person affected. In addition to the physical effects of toenail fungus, it also can interfere with person’s social life. Some people, for example, avoid wearing toeless shoes or taking their shoes off around others because they are embarrassed about the appearance. Chiropodists (Foot Health Specialists) at We-Fix-U Foot Health Centres in Cobourg, are providing their patients with a leading therapy to improve the appearance of nails affected by fungus through the use of a new noninvasive laser therapy system. The system applies laser energy to the nail plate and surrounding tissue. The laser light gradually heats the fungus and promotes the growth of healthy, clear nails. Topical treatments have been somewhat effective, however, they are limited to treating minor infections and patients must apply the medication up to twice a day for a year. While oral drugs have exhibited some success rate, such treatment is associated with common adverse side effects, including gastrointestinal and skin disorders, headaches and abnormal liver function. HAVE YOU HEARD ABOUT GLA:D™ CANADA? GLA:D ® is an evidence-based program for treatment and management of osteoarthritic symptoms. It is currently being implemented by Bone and Joint Canada, supported by the Canadian Orthopaedic Foundation. What to Expect. GLA:D™Canada is an8week educationand targetedneuromuscular exercise program developed in Denmark and has been shown to produce positive long term outcomes (1 year post program) in over 10,000 participants. Results at one year follow-up include: • A 27% reduction in pain intensity • A 37% and 45% reduction in use of joint related pain medications for knee and hip OA participants respectively 10% reduction in sick days for GLA:D® participants with knee OA • 10% increase in walking speed • An over 30% increase in self-reported physical activity levels Arthritis sufferers can now stop living with pain! Exercise Essentials

LEVATOR SCAPULAE STRETCH Grasp your arm on the affected side and tilt your head downward into the armpit. Use your opposite hand to guide your head further into the stretch. Repeat 3 times. Try this movement if you are experiencing neck pain.

CHIN TUCK SUPINE Lie with roll under neck. Without lifting head, tuck chin gently. Keep the large muscles in the neck relaxed. Repeat 5 times.

Relieves neck pain

Stretches neck

ARE GROWING PAINS REAL?

It would start with a mild ache and gradually worsen to a deep throb, forcing me to rub my shin with my other foot, doing what I could to stop the pain. I remember this pain like it was yesterday. When I was younger I used to frequently wake up, howling in pain and clutching my shins. My mom would cuddle me, place warm cloths on my legs and rub them in attempt to comfort me. I remember trips to several doctors; my mother constantly searching for new opinions, but without fail was always told that I suffered from “growing pains”. Does this sound familiar? My mother never really accepted my given diagnosis because all children grow, but not all children experience pain. The reality is that growing pains are real and affect about 20% of children (numbers vary depending on which study you read). Growing pains are essentially pains in the leg muscles (not the joints), experienced frequently or infrequently, in children aged 2-12 years of age. Pain generally occurs at night. Nobody fully understands why they happen, but one thing is clear: they have nothing to do with growth. The term “growing pains” first came to fruition in the 1800’s, but since then medical professionals have realized that the pain doesn’t correspond to a period of rapid growth. Unfortunately, the name stuck. I’d prefer to call it “non-inflammatory pre-pubescent nocturnal leg pain syndrome”, but I guess “growing pains” is faster and easier to say. The most accepted cause of growing pains is muscle fatigue from over-activity. This theory meshes with parental observations that growing pains are often worse on nights after sports practices or long periods spent walking or running. In my profession we also correlate growing pains with feet that aren’t aligned and supported properly. Poor foot alignment and function cause instability of the feet during weight bearing activities and can be a significant cause of growing pains in children, particularly in children who have very flat feet, ankles which roll inward and are very flexible. This causes uneven weight bearing through the foot as well as misalignment of joints further up the body, causing muscle strain. Growing pains do tend to run in families. This holds true with my own family. My husband and I both experienced growing pains when we were children and our children have shared this same experience (that’s how we know when they have failed to listen to their “foot specialist” parents and chose to wear shoes which are less than suitable. See, mom always does know best!).

Growing pains is characterized by aching or throbbing pain in one or both legs at night. There is no swelling, not visible sign of injury, no pain when touched and does not cause your child to limp. If your child wakes up complaining of aching, throbbing legs, try the following to soothe his or her discomfort: • Apply warm cloths or a heating pad to the aching area. Remove once your child has fallen asleep. • Have your child get up and walk • Rub your child’s legs with a soothing cream • Have your child stretch the muscles in their leg • If all else fails, try giving your child a pain reliever. Offer your child ibuprofen or acetaminophen. • To prevent growing pains, have your child wear supportive shoes, especially with increased activity. If your child experiences growing pains, make an appointment with a Chiropodist, who will determine if your child has a foot problem which may be causing his or her night time pain, and will discuss appropriate and effective treatment options.
